EditNews Admin Template : оформление новостей в админ панели


Модуль, устанавливаемый в DLE через систему управления плагинами, позволит вывести нужную информацию о новости на странице списка новостей в админ панели.
 
Модуль позволяет не только настроить вывод таблицы списка новостей, но и вывести:
  • Название новости
  • Список категорий
  • Иконку категории
  • Дату новости
  • Настраиваемую дату новости
  • Ссылку на новость
    Ссылку на редактирование новости
  • Меню с редактированием комментариев, удалением комментариев и просмотром новости
  • Рейтинг новости (числовой)
  • Количество голосов в рейтинге
  • Количество комментариев
  • Количество просмотров
  • ID новости
  • Автора новости
  • Ссылку на редактирование автора новости
  • Текст в зависимости зафиксирована ли новость или нет
  • Текст в зависимости проверена ли новость или нет
  • Текст в зависимости требует ли новость пароль или нет
  • Текст в зависимости есть ли в новости опрос или нет
  • Текст в зависимости разрешены ли комментарии в новости или нет
  • Текст в зависимости разрешен ли рейтинг новости или нет
  • Дату редактирования новости
  • Настраиваемую дату редактирования новости
  • Автора редактирования новости
  • Причину редактирования новости
  • Текст в зависимости была ли редактирована новость
  • Теги новости
  • Дополнительные поля (кроме доп поле типа: Галерея, Изображение, Файл)
  • Условия дополнительных полей ([ifxfvalue])


Описание, используемых в файле content.tpl, тегов шаблона:
{title} - название новости.
{news-id} - ID новости.
{date} - дата добавления.
{date=формат даты} - выводит дату в заданном в теге формате. Тем самым вы можете выводить не только дату целиком, но и ее отдельные части. Формат даты задается задается согласно формату принятому в PHP. Например тег {date=d} выведет день месяца публикации новости или комментария, а тег {date=F} выведет название месяца, а тег {date=d-m-Y H:i} выведет полную дату и время.
{comm-link} - меню с редактированием комментариев, удалением комментариев и просмотром новости.
{category} - категории новости.
{views} - количество просмотров новости.
{comments-num} - количество комментариев новости.
{category-icon} - иконка главной категории новости.
{author} - автор новости.
{full-link} - ссылка на новость.
{edit-link} - ссылка на редактирование новости.
{edit-user} - ссылка на редактирование автора новости.
{rating} - рейтинг новости.
{vote-rating} - количество голосов рейтинга новости.
[approve] текст [/approve]	- выводит текст если новость опубликована на сайте.
[not-approve] текст [/not-approve] - выводит текст если новость НЕ опубликована на сайте.
[fixed] текст [/fixed] - выводит текст если новость зафиксирована на сайте.
[not-fixed] текст [/not-fixed] - выводит текст если новость НЕ зафиксирована на сайте.
[password] текст [/password] - выводит текст если для просмотра новости требуется пароль.
[not-password] текст [/not-password] - выводит текст если для просмотра новости НЕ требуется пароль.
[poll] текст [/poll] - выводит текст если в новости есть опрос.
[not-poll] текст [/not-poll] - выводит текст если в новости НЕТ опроса.
[comments] текст [/comments] - выводит текст если комментарии для новости разрешены.
[not-comments] текст [/not-comments] - выводит текст если комментарии для новости НЕ разрешены.
[rating] текст [/rating] - выводит текст если разрешен рейтинг для новости.
[not-rating] текст [/not-rating] - выводит текст если НЕ разрешен рейтинг для новости.
[editdate] текст [/editdate] - выводит текст если новость была отредактирована.
[not-editdate] текст [/not-editdate] - выводит текст если новость НЕ была отредактирована.
{edit-date} - дата редактирования новости.
{editdate=формат даты} - выводит дату в заданном в теге формате. Тем самым вы можете выводить не только дату целиком но и ее отдельные части. Формат даты задается задается согласно формату принятому в PHP. Например тег {editdate=d} выведет день месяца редактирования новости, а тег {editdate=F} выведет название месяца, а тег {editdate=d-m-Y H:i} выведет полную дату и время.
[edit-reason] текст [/edit-reason] - выводит текст если при редактировании была указана причина редактирования.
{editor} - автор редактирования новости.
{edit-reason} - причина редактирования новости.
[tags] текст [/tags] - выводит текст если у новости заполнены теги.
{tags} - теги новости.
[xfvalue_x] - значение дополнительного поля "x", где "x" название дополнительного поля.
[xfgiven_x] текст [/xfgiven_x] - выводит текст если дополнительное поле не пустое, где "x" название дополнительного поля.
[xfnotgiven_X] текст [/xfnotgiven_X] - выводит текст если дополнительное поле пустое, где "x" название дополнительного поля.
[ifxfvalue tagname="tagvalue"] Текст [/ifxfvalue]	 - выводят текст заключенный в них, если значение дополнительного поля совпадает с указанным. Где tagname это имя дополнительного поля, а tagvalue это его значение.
[ifxfvalue tagname!="tagvalue"] Текст [/ifxfvalue] - выводят текст заключенный в них, если значение поля не совпадает с указанным. Где tagname это имя дополнительного поля, а tagvalue это его значение.

Скачать: файл могут только зарегистрированные пользователи.

Скачать: файл могут только зарегистрированные пользователи.

Скачать: файл могут только зарегистрированные пользователи.
 
Версия DLE: 13.0-13.2
Кодировка: utf-8
Автор: LazyDev
Источник:
  • Oxigen
  • 0
  • 282
Информация
Оставлять комментарии могут только зарегистрированные посетители.
  • Рейтинг@Mail.ru
  • Яндекс.Метрика